Acute bronchitis is an inflammation of the breathing tubes (bronchi), which causes increased mucus production and other changes. It is usually caused by bacteria or viruses, can be serious in people who have pulmonary or cardiac diseases, and can lead to pneumonia.

Warfarin was developed as a consequence of the study of a strange bleeding disorder that suddenly occurred in cattle on the northern prairies of the United States in the early 1900s.
